The Mooncake Festival
The mooncake festival is the second most important festival celebrated by the Chinese community. It is on 24 September this year. Chinese families have a reunion dinner and offer food sacrifices to the moon.
The mooncake is the main characteristic food.
If the weather is clear, families like to eat mooncakes and gaze at the full moon in their garden or at a park.
Children light candles in lanterns and have a lantern procession. There is often a neighbourhood lantern procession on Mooncake Festival Day.

What is Puppy Caring?
The puppy caring program requires volunteers to care for a puppy in their home from the age of 8 weeks, until they are approximately 12-15 months of age, before entering the training program. The puppy will be with you in everyday situations including going to school which has been proven to have a positive impact on health and wellbeing.
Seeing Eye Dogs provide all the equipment, food, training and support needed through regular home visits from a Seeing Eye Dogs Puppy Development Trainer, group training days and socialisation days. Various caring options are available.
